Output 44d423e636a62f79c49bf6e361be991f4f5397fefc902f5000b44056ea377e3e:1

value
25533351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911ac006fdd5f17267ee3aad9f6ae5f1982da32f OP_EQUAL
address
3EvFwzKnpozCqyvF1LB8GJJxStduA445gA
transaction
44d423e636a62f79c49bf6e361be991f4f5397fefc902f5000b44056ea377e3e
spent
true